Following the recent derecho storm, many local businesses in Perry have come together.

Perry Chamber of Commerce Director Lynsi Pasutti tells Raccoon Valley Radio she’s been working very closely with the local merchants group and relays the message they are in high spirits, “It’s different for everybody, really, as far as damage and getting power back, and what it’s taken them to get back to ‘normal.’ But, I think we’re seeing the community really coming together, which has been one positive thing that’s come out of this. People are helping each other out and checking in on each other. So that is a good thing to see, despite the circumstances.” 

Cleanup efforts continue throughout the City as contractors continue to work on picking up brush. After the curbside collection of storm debris is completed, city crews will then start on the special request alley pick-ups. Residents may still bring storm debris to the Pattee Park campground parking lot.
